Transaction 338c9139055f04a2b42a7a8b522d1af8de16b2ca7e0cd57dad856aecc5e4a242
3 Input
2 Outputs
- 338c9139055f04a2b42a7a8b522d1af8de16b2ca7e0cd57dad856aecc5e4a242:0
- 338c9139055f04a2b42a7a8b522d1af8de16b2ca7e0cd57dad856aecc5e4a242:1
value 280000000
address 1EcmkFMCgDGGeR558X5BYMs2MJn6QvDCtZ
value 53311
address 1KpbddHyeCFje5XvgVDxoHt47REoaGvSrG